Ancestors
Individuals from whom one is descended, typically beyond the immediate parents, including grandparents, great-grandparents, and so forth.
Biological Perspective
An approach in psychology that examines psychological issues by looking at their physiological, genetic, and developmental underpinnings.
Bipolar Disorder
A mental disorder characterized by extreme mood swings, including episodes of mania and depression.
Manic Phase
A period characterized by elevated mood, overactivity, inflated self-esteem, and reduced need for sleep, often seen in bipolar disorder.
